You can set up the installing brace that will hold up your disposal. You can install the disposal and hook it up to the drain plumbing.
Raise the disposal somewhat and loosen up the lower placing ring by pushing or pulling wrenches or screwdriver to the left up until the disposal is totally free from installing setting up. Lay the disposal on its side and remove the electric cover plate. Loose the green ground screw and eliminate the cord connectors.
Loosen up screws on the electric clamp connector and get rid of cables from the disposal. To remove the existing installing hardware, loosen the 3 installing screws. Tear the breeze ring off with a screwdriver and eliminate the old installing assembly, after that press the old sink flange up via the sinkhole. Utilize a screwdriver or putty blade to carefully scuff all old putty from the edge of the sinkhole.
Go down the brand-new sink flange into the drain opening and press it right into location. Putting a weight such as your disposal on top of the sink flange will certainly help hold the sink flange in location while mounting the sink flange to the sink. To avoid scraping your sink or the flange, put a towel between the sink surface area and the weight from under the sink.
Next, get rid of the loose knockout plug from inside of the disposal. Lay the disposal on its side under the sink so you can make the electric links. Ensure the breaker is off. Get rid of the plate under of the disposal to subject the wiring and usage cord adapters to connect the cables from the disposal to the matching cords from the power supply.
Change the plate, to cover the cables. All advancement models set up likewise, though there are a couple of additional actions with the cover control, extra on that momentarily. Initially, for all models aside from cover control, hang the disposal by lining up the 3 mounting tabs with the slide up ramps on the placing ring.
The disposal will now hang on its own. Put the discharge tube into the discharge coupler, then glide the clamp over the discharge tube and placement it in the groove over the rubber tailpipe coupler. Rotate the disposal so that the discharge tube is aligned with the drain trap. If the discharge tube is also long, removed as much of television as necessary.
If you are connecting the disposal to a dishwashing machine it may be linked via an air space. Utilize a pipe clamp to connect the drain hose to the dishwashing machine inlet. Since every little thing is mounted and in placement, secure the disposal to the sink mounting assembly making use of the unique wrench that featured the device.
For the cover control model, the sink baffle was placed in area at the factory. If it has actually been gotten rid of, it would be a lot less complicated to put it now prior to installing the unit. Hang the disposal by straightening the three mounting tabs with the slide up ramps onto the installing ring.
The disposal will certainly now hang on its own. Place the discharge tube right into the discharge coupler, after that slide the clamp over the discharge tube and position it in the groove on the rubber tailpipe coupler. Turn the disposal so that the discharge tube is lined up with the drainpipe trap. If the discharge tube is as well lengthy removed as a lot of the tube as essential.
If you are attaching the disposal to a dish washer it may be connected to an air space. Utilize a pipe clamp to attach the drain hose to the dish washer inlet. Since everything is set up and ready, secure the disposal to the sink installing setting up utilizing the special wrench that featured the system.
It snaps right into position on 2 of the 3 bolts on the mounting assembly. For all models, you ought to check for leaks at the sink flange dishwashing machine tailpipe and placing assembly links. Turn on the electric breaker to evaluate its operation.

A garbage disposal that hums or appears like metal grinding on metal is an excellent sign that it's time to replace it. Bear in mind that a waste disposal unit that isn't working right could be revived with a simple repair. Here are a couple of points to try prior to running to the equipment store and buying a brand-new unit.
Make use of a flashlight to look for things that might have gotten lodged, and get them with a pair of tongs or needle-nose pliers. Second, look beneath the waste disposal unit and situate the hole straight in the facility. Utilizing a hex wrench or a conventional Allen wrench, revolve the wrench back and forth to by hand reset the motor.
If none of these techniques function, it's time to go in advance and change the rubbish disposal. Unlike various other home renovation projects that may require a range of unique tools, to replace a garbage disposal, you'll primarily need tools you most likely currently have on hand.
It's a great concept to take a photo of your existing waste disposal unit so you can make certain you're changing each item in the best order. After that, open package with the new waste disposal unit inside. Verify that it includes all of the pieces that are identical to the old unit.
Head to your main circuit breaker and transform off power to the system. There may be a breaker dedicated to the garbage disposal, or you could have to shut off power to the entire kitchen.
The discharge tube is the pipeline that expands from the side of the disposal and includes the ground pipes. Get rid of the discharge pipeline by loosening any kind of screws or nuts with a screwdriver. Remove the old strainer to the rubbish disposal. Find the slim metal ring on the old waste disposal unit.
Different the disposal from the power supply by turning the device over and finding the faceplate for the electrical real estate. Remove the sink flange by wiggling or pushing beneath the flange and raising it out from the top.
Apply plumbing professional's putty to the underside of the new sink flange. Continue the slender end of the flange against the drainpipe opening and press the flange in position. Hold the brand-new flange in place for at the very least 30 secs so the putty can adhere correctly. Given that you don't want the new flange to move while you're mounting the new waste disposal unit, ask a helper to firmly weigh down on it while you're functioning.
